Location - Chevin Court is situated within the town centre of Otley and all local amenities are on hand. Set in a convenient location with walks alongside the river and through the park. Otley itself is a thriving market town surrounded by the picturesque Wharfedale countryside, providing an extensive range of shops, schools, restaurants and recreation facilities. Harrogate and the commercial centres of Leeds and Bradford are within comfortable daily commuting distance either by car, bus or nearby rail services. For those wishing to travel further afield the Leeds / Bradford International Airport is only a short drive away.
